Transaction 652fc6f54a24ad81439565c7415244f9a7530f13e4aac393866cadd997c30c1e
1 Input
1 Output
-
652fc6f54a24ad81439565c7415244f9a7530f13e4aac393866cadd997c30c1e:0
- value
- 304400
- script pubkey
- OP_0 OP_PUSHBYTES_20 27fbd15c5d94d88f40da5c6892dd04426d2091f4
- address
- bc1qylaazhzajnvg7sx6t35f9hgygfkjpy05nwuxd7